Abstract
The utility model discloses a kind of elevator door guide shoe device for fast detecting, including the right angle block that can be filled in sill slot and main scale body, right angle block include upper surface for origin reference location the short block of layer gate guide shoe bottom and with short slab vertical strip connected vertically, it is connected with and the vertically disposed connecting rod/connecting plate of right angle block at the top of vertical strip, connecting rod/connecting plate other end is fixedly connected on main scale body, vertical plate moving up and down is provided on main scale body, vertical plate bottom is provided with lower surface and is used for origin reference location in sill slot slot along upper locating piece, the second scale for measurement is provided on vertical plate;The utility model is equipped with the right angle block that can be filled in sill slot, right angle block is vertically connected with vertical measuring scale, using vertical measuring scale positioning sill slot slot along position, gate layer gate guide shoe insertion sill groove depth can be directly read in vertical measuring scale, measurement numerical value is accurate, accuracy is high, speed is fast, easy to operate, reduces used during elevator falling accident.

Background technique
Currently, elevator refers to the power drive the case where, using the cabinet run along rigid guideway, lifting transport is carried out
People, cargo electromechanical equipment;Elevator cage is mounted on the lower section of elevator door 1 and car door, is fastened on door-plate lower part
Layer gate guide shoe is inserted from above into sill groove, cooperates the horizontal direction for realizing elevator door to slide with guide groove, level sliding
The guiding role of layer door level run may be implemented in the layer gate guide shoe 2 of layer door bottom in landing sill slot 3, and layer gate guide shoe 2 exists
There should be enough depths of engagement in sill slot, prevent under external force, layer gate guide shoe is detached from sill, causes personnel from layer door
The accident fallen occurs.
Common elevator door is moved in baltimore groove by layer gate guide shoe on sill, and such elevator door operates in detection
Or during visiting, it should be noted that some once:
1. sill to layer gate guide shoe longitudinally upward movement and position there is no limit, generate change when door-plate is hit
When shape, layer gate guide shoe, which is easy to be pulled up, even to be deviate from from guide groove, so that the limit of sill end of door plate and guiding be made to make
With weakening or losing, causes door of elevator to open because losing lower limit, influence the people of elevator user of service and periphery personnel
Body safety.
2. special validation layer gate guide shoe insertion sill is needed to lead in order to ensure the reliable limit of door-plate and guiding, when door-plate is installed
Depth into slot when depth is inadequate, be easy to cause security risk.
Existing gate layer gate guide shoe measurement is measured using vernier caliper or ruler, since sill groove groove width is narrow,
Elevator door and ground distance are small, and vernier caliper, which is difficult to be inserted into groove, to be measured, and ruler can only also be tilted and is put into groove, no
The depth in measurement layer gate guide shoe insertion groove accurately and fast can be reached.
